Geography Teacher – Croydon – September 2025

Full time. Permanent. Suitable for ECTs or experienced teachers

A purposeful and community-driven secondary school in Croydon is looking for a Geography Teacher to join its welcoming Humanities team in September 2025. This is a permanent, full time role with the potential for additional responsibility or Sixth Form teaching for the right candidate.

Geography is at the heart of the school’s academic curriculum and is seen as a powerful subject for helping students interpret the world around them. This is a school where staff are trusted to teach well, encouraged to share ideas, and supported to grow professionally.

What makes this school a great place to teach
This is a school that believes in strong pastoral care, clear routines and a curriculum built on deep subject knowledge. Classrooms are calm and focused. Students are respectful and motivated, and staff are given the tools and time to make an impact. There is a genuine sense of shared purpose and community.

Located within easy reach of central Croydon, the school is well connected by public transport and close to green space. Teachers benefit from supportive leadership, structured CPD, and a culture that values both wellbeing and ambition.

Inside the geography department
Geography is a popular subject at GCSE and contributes to the school’s growing Sixth Form offer. The department delivers a well-sequenced curriculum built around big ideas and case study depth. Fieldwork, enquiry and debate are woven throughout, helping students connect physical and human geography in meaningful ways.

There is strong collaboration within the Humanities faculty, and staff are encouraged to share resources, reflect on pedagogy and bring creativity to lessons. The right candidate will enjoy developing and delivering high-quality geography lessons to pupils who are curious and capable.

This role will suit a teacher who

  • Has qualified teacher status in Geography

  • Can deliver engaging lessons to KS3 and KS4 students

  • Is reflective, organised and enjoys working in a team

  • Wants to be part of a school that values inclusion, high expectations and a knowledge-rich curriculum

  • May have an interest in A Level teaching or subject leadership in future
